- [ ] **Step 7: Breaker override escrow.** After sealing the signing keys for the Tallgrove upstream API circuit breaker, confirm the support team can force the breaker open during a full outage. The override bundle lives in the sealed escrow drawer and is useless without its unlock phrase. Two ceremony witnesses must initial this step before proceeding. The escrow bundle is decrypted with the recovery passphrase that follows.

vault phrase of kahip-kahop = holath-quenmir

# Break-Glass: Catalog Cache Invalidation

Scope: the Pinrow product catalog at Veldstone Retail. If stale prices persist after a purge and the Hollowmere invalidation queue is wedged, use break-glass to flush the edge tier directly. Contractors: get verbal sign-off from the catalog lead first. Steps: open the Hollowmere admin shell, select emergency-flush, confirm the tenant, and run it once — repeated flushes thrash the origin. Access is logged and expires after 20 minutes. Unseal the admin shell with the passphrase below.

recovery phrase for kahop-tajog: istix-casvan

## Service Account: receipt-mailer

The donation-receipt mailer at Brightlark Foundation runs under the `svc-receipts` account. It polls the GivingLedger queue every ten minutes, renders PDF receipts, and hands them to the Postwren delivery service. If the account is recreated, re-grant read access on the `donations` topic and send rights on the outbound relay. Rotation happens quarterly; update both the staging and production secrets stores, then restart the mailer pods. The key for the Postwren delivery endpoint is below.

API key for yahig-tadup: kto7_ubizbYm